Class MavenConfigFolderOverrideProperty

java.lang.Object
hudson.model.AbstractDescribableImpl<com.cloudbees.hudson.plugins.folder.AbstractFolderProperty<?>>
com.cloudbees.hudson.plugins.folder.AbstractFolderProperty<com.cloudbees.hudson.plugins.folder.AbstractFolder<?>>
org.jenkinsci.plugins.pipeline.maven.MavenConfigFolderOverrideProperty
All Implemented Interfaces:
ExtensionPoint, Describable<com.cloudbees.hudson.plugins.folder.AbstractFolderProperty<?>>, ReconfigurableDescribable<com.cloudbees.hudson.plugins.folder.AbstractFolderProperty<?>>

public class MavenConfigFolderOverrideProperty extends com.cloudbees.hudson.plugins.folder.AbstractFolderProperty<com.cloudbees.hudson.plugins.folder.AbstractFolder<?>>
Provides a way to override maven configuration at a folder level
  • Constructor Details

    • MavenConfigFolderOverrideProperty

      @DataBoundConstructor public MavenConfigFolderOverrideProperty()
      Constructor.
  • Method Details

    • isOverride

      public boolean isOverride()
    • setOverride

      @DataBoundSetter public void setOverride(boolean override)
    • getSettings

      public SettingsProvider getSettings()
    • setSettings

      protected void setSettings(SettingsProvider settings)
    • getGlobalSettings

      public GlobalSettingsProvider getGlobalSettings()
    • setGlobalSettings

      protected void setGlobalSettings(GlobalSettingsProvider globalSettings)